Hope Hamilton CofE Primary School Catchment Area

Reviewed by the catchment.school editorial team · Last updated 15 March 2026

Hope Hamilton CofE Primary School is a academy converter primary school in Leicester , serving pupils aged 5–11, with 454 pupils, and a capacity of 446 places. The school is currently at or above capacity, making catchment area proximity important for admissions.

Hope Hamilton CofE Primary School Catchment Area Information

Admission to Hope Hamilton CofE Primary School is managed by Leicester and typically includes both faith criteria and catchment area proximity. The weighting given to each criterion depends on the school's published oversubscription policy, which is reviewed annually.

Currently oversubscribed: 454 pupils enrolled against a capacity of 446 places. Living within the catchment area is especially important for this school.

The official admissions policy — including the catchment boundary map — is published by Leicester before each admissions cycle. Always verify your address with the council before submitting an application, as boundaries can change year to year.
